Program & Curriculum

 
 
 

Kids & Company Preschool utilizes a teacher created thematic curriculum that emphasizes experiential and sensory learning. Throughout our curriculum we celebrate the seasons and special times of the year. Readiness skills are integrated throughout our day in fun and creative ways. Our activities are developmentally appropriate and take into consideration individual differences in interest, attention span, physical development, and maturity.

Daily classroom routines offer a balance of the following: active and quiet times; large and small group activities; teacher and student directed activities; self-motivated group and independent play; and indoor/outdoor exploration. Activities include games, music, story time, arts and crafts, show and tell, and free choice. Experiences in early math, language arts and science are incorporated throughout the day. Classroom schedules are flexible and tailored to the needs of each class and take into account basic routines and transition times such as arrival, departure, snack time, and self-help skills.

Teachers

 
 
 

Kids & Company Preschool was founded in the Fall of 2000 as an ear;y educational opportunity incorporating religious faith values. Kids & Company is a unique endeavor that has been nurtured by caring teachers with complementary philosophies, skills, and teaching styles. Our preschool began as, and still is, a truly child-focused, family enriched program.

Kids & Company is managed cooperatively, with each teacher actively participating in the development of curriculum and programs. Our teachers have rich and diverse talents, educational backgrounds and experiences – all of which contribute to the high quality of our preschool. Individual teachers retain membership in various professional organizations including the National Association for the Education of Young Children. Staff members are certified by the American Red Cross in infant, child and Adult CPR as well as first aid.

While Kids & Company Preschool is a license-exempt ministry, we believe in the concept of excellence. Our classrooms and curriculum not only meet, but often exceed the licensing standards set forth by the State of Illinois. The United Methodist Church of New Lenox Board of Trustees and Administrative Council currently monitor Kids & Company Preschool. In addition, our preschool is under the direct supervision of the UMC Family Life Committee. We are extremely fortunate to be a part of such a committed and supportive community!
